A zoning system divides your home into separate temperature zones, each with independent control. This solves the "too hot upstairs, too cold downstairs" problem.
How Zoning Works
Components - **Zone dampers:** Motorized plates in ductwork - **Zone thermostats:** One per zone - **Control panel:** Coordinates all zones - **Bypass damper:** Prevents pressure issues
Operation Each zone calls for heating/cooling independently. Dampers open/close to direct conditioned air only where needed.
Benefits of Zoning
Comfort - Different temperatures for different areas - Accommodate different preferences - Eliminate hot/cold spots
Energy Savings - Don't condition unoccupied areas - Reduce overall runtime - 20-30% typical savings
Flexibility - Day zones vs. night zones - Home office separate from living areas - Guest rooms on demand

Zoning Costs
Equipment - Basic 2-zone system: $2,000-$3,500 - Multi-zone system: $3,500-$7,000 - Includes dampers, thermostats, panel
Professional Installation - Labor: $500-$1,500 - May require ductwork modifications
Total Investment - 2-zone: $2,500-$5,000 - 4-zone: $4,500-$8,500
Alternatives to Traditional Zoning
Mini-Split Systems - Natural zone control - No ductwork needed - Higher efficiency
Smart Thermostats with Sensors - Room-by-room monitoring - Adjust based on occupancy - Less equipment required
